Mercedes-Benz said it will no longer produce compact models: A-Class, GLA or will it be "out of print"?

Recently, Mercedes-Benz in-depth discussion about the future of its models of the planning, due to the current global chip shortage, Mercedes-Benz's current model is relatively compact, chip demand should be distributed according to demand, Mercedes-Benz may decide not to upgrade its compact models, after all, Mercedes-Benz A-class and Mercedes-Benz GLA compared to other models, demand and sales performance is inferior.

According to the original Mercedes-Benz new car plan, mercedes-benz A-class will stop production in 2025 and will not introduce replacement products. Although the plan is still tentative, it seems that this matter is already a foregone conclusion. Let's take a look at the sales volume of Mercedes-Benz A-class in China, compared with the sales ranking of BBA under the same luxury brand: Audi A3, Mercedes-Benz A-Class, BMW 1 Series, of which Mercedes-Benz A-Class sales sell 2600+ units per month, as an entry-level model performance is still good.

The Mercedes-Benz A-Class will be discontinued and replaced by a pure electric model, which will better compensate for the current chip shortage but cannot be supplied in time. At present, the Mercedes-Benz A-Class does not have a particularly suitable replacement object, but in the SUV camp, Mercedes-Benz also has a compact SUV: Mercedes-Benz GLA has a replacement object, that is, Mercedes-Benz EQA. Mercedes-Benz said it may no longer replace its compact size models, including the Mercedes-Benz GLA in SUVs.
